Reported Volume Accuracy

Calculation

Reported Volume Accuracy, within cryptocurrency, options, and derivatives, represents the degree to which exchange-reported trading volume aligns with actual transaction data, often assessed through trade reconstruction and order book analysis. Discrepancies can stem from wash trading, inaccurate reporting mechanisms, or discrepancies in aggregation methodologies employed by different venues. Accurate volume reporting is critical for price discovery, liquidity assessment, and effective risk management, influencing the reliability of market signals.
